Software Engineer 3

Wyetech is a company that works on breaking technological barriers and solving real-world problems for federal government customers.
Columbia, MD, USA
$179,296 - $283,442
Backend
Principal Software Engineer
In-Person
20+ years of experience
AI · Cybersecurity
This job posting may no longer be active. You may be interested in these related jobs instead:
Principal Software Engineer - Core Platform

Principal Software Engineer role at Addepar to lead Core Product Platform development, architecting scalable solutions for wealth management technology.

Principal Software Engineer

Principal Software Engineer role at Microsoft's Purview & Data Security Team, leading high-scale security services with up to 100% remote work flexibility.

Principal Software Engineer

Remote Principal Software Engineer position at Re:Build Manufacturing, leading architecture and development of manufacturing software systems with 10+ years experience required.

Principal Software Engineer

Principal Software Engineer position at Favor, leading technical initiatives and mentoring teams while building scalable solutions for their delivery platform in Austin, TX.

Principal Software Engineer

Lead the development of AI software toolchains at Microsoft, focusing on hardware simulation, performance modeling, and developer tools for AI accelerators.

Description For Software Engineer 3

At Wyetech, you'll be at the center of an award-winning corporate culture, breaking technological barriers and solving real-world problems for our federal government customers. We are committed to hiring the best of the best, and in return, we offer a world-class, truly unique employee experience that is rare within our industry.

The Software Engineer 3 role involves developing, maintaining, and enhancing complex and diverse software systems based on documented requirements. Key responsibilities include:

  • Analyzing user requirements to derive software design and performance requirements
  • Debugging existing software and correcting defects
  • Designing and coding new software or modifying existing software to add new features
  • Integrating existing software into new or modified systems or operating environments
  • Developing and implementing complex algorithms and database interfaces
  • Serving as a team lead and overseeing software development teams
  • Ensuring quality control of all developed and modified software

This position requires a TS/SCI clearance with agency appropriate polygraph due to federal contract requirements. The ideal candidate will have 20 years of experience as a Software Engineer in programs of similar scope, type, and complexity.

Wyetech offers an exceptional benefits package, including:

  • 20% automatic contribution to a SEP IRA for retirement
  • Generous PTO plan of up to 200 hours annually
  • Choice of medical plan options, some with Health Savings Account (HSA)
  • Vision and dental insurance
  • Life and AD&D benefits
  • Short and long-term disability
  • Various team-building events throughout the year

Join Wyetech to work on cutting-edge technology while enjoying a supportive and rewarding work environment.

Last updated 6 months ago

Responsibilities For Software Engineer 3

  • Analyze user requirements to derive software design and performance requirements
  • Debug existing software and correct defects
  • Design and code new software or modify existing software to add new features
  • Integrate existing software into new or modified systems or operating environments
  • Develop or implement complex algorithms and database interfaces
  • Serve as team lead and oversee software development teams
  • Ensure quality control of all developed and modified software
  • Confer with system engineers and hardware engineers to derive software requirements
  • Recommend new technologies and processes for complex software projects

Requirements For Software Engineer 3

Java
Python
  • TS/SCI with agency appropriate poly
  • Twenty (20) years experience as a SWE in programs and contracts of similar scope, type, and complexity
  • Bachelor's degree in Computer Science or related discipline from an accredited college or university (or 4 years additional SWE experience as substitute)
  • Ansible
  • Java
  • Python
  • Virtualization

Benefits For Software Engineer 3

401k
Dental Insurance
Medical Insurance
Vision Insurance
  • 20% automatic contribution to SEP IRA
  • Up to 200 hours of PTO annually
  • Choice of medical plan options (some with HSA)
  • Vision and dental insurance
  • Life and AD&D benefits
  • Short and long-term disability
  • Hospital Indemnity, Accident, and Critical Illness Insurances
  • Optional Identity Theft and Legal Protection Services
  • Employee Referral Bonus up to $10,000
  • Team-building events
  • Two complementary branded clothing orders annually

Interested in this job?